Land area equipped for irrigation — Share in Cropland in Northern Africa
Northern Africa: Land area equipped for irrigation — Share in Cropland was 20.12 % in 2024. ▲ Rising
Land area equipped for irrigation — Share in Cropland in Northern Africa, 1961–2024
Source: Food and Agriculture Organization of the United Nations. Measured in %.
Analysis
Northern Africa recorded 20.12 % for land area equipped for irrigation — share in cropland in 2024.
That represents a change of down 0.2% on the previous year and up 1.9% over ten years.
Over the whole period, land area equipped for irrigation — share in cropland in Northern Africa peaked at 20.16 % in 2023 and was at its lowest, 15.9 %, in 1962.
Northern Africa ranks 9th of 31 groups on this measure, in the middle of the range.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 64 years of available data.

About this data
The FAOSTAT Land Use domain contains data on twenty-one land use categories and twenty-three categories of irrigation and agricultural practices. Data are available yearly and by country, regional and global levels. The domain includes Land Use Indicators providing information on the percentage share of agricultural and forest land, and their sub-components, including irrigated areas and areas under organic agriculture, within a country land use matrix. Data are available at country, regional and global level, for the following elements: (in percentage) i) Share in Land area; ii) Share in Agricultural land, iii) Share in Cropland; and iv) Share in Forest land; (in ha/pc) v) Area per capita.
